Medication Costs: Topical vs. Oral Treatments

Medications are a common first-line treatment for hair loss. These come in topical and oral forms, each with different price points.

Topical Minoxidil

Topical minoxidil (e.g., Rogaine, Minoxidil Viñas 5%) is an over-the-counter solution that stimulates hair growth when applied directly to the scalp. It’s available as a liquid or foam.

  • Cost: Typically, a one-month supply ranges from 20€ to 40€, depending on the brand and concentration.
  • How it works: Minoxidil widens blood vessels in the scalp, improving blood flow to hair follicles and promoting growth.
  • Expected results: Noticeable results usually appear after 3-6 months of consistent use.
  • Timeline: Continuous use is necessary to maintain results.
  • Potential side effects: Scalp irritation, unwanted hair growth in other areas, and temporary shedding.

Oral Finasteride and Dutasteride

Oral finasteride (e.g., Propecia) and dutasteride (Avodart) are prescription medications that inhibit the production of dihydrotestosterone (DHT), a hormone that causes hair follicles to shrink in androgenetic alopecia (male pattern baldness).   • Cost: A one-month supply of finasteride 1mg can range from 30€ to 60€, while dutasteride 0.5mg may cost between 40€ and 70€.
  • How they work: These medications block the enzyme 5-alpha reductase, which converts testosterone to DHT.
  • Expected results: Reduced hair loss and potential regrowth can be seen after 3-6 months of consistent use.
  • Timeline: Long-term use is required to maintain results.
  • Potential side effects: Sexual side effects (e.g., decreased libido, erectile dysfunction), though rare, are possible.

Surgical Procedures: Hair Transplants

Hair transplant surgery involves moving hair follicles from a donor area (usually the back of the head) to balding areas. There are two main types:

  •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T): A strip of scalp is removed, and hair follicles are dissected and transplanted.
  •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E): Individual hair follicles are extracted and transplanted.
  • Cost: Hair transplant costs vary widely depending on the extent of hair loss, the number of grafts needed, and the surgeon's experience. Typically, a hair transplant can range from 3,000€ to 15,000€.
  • How it works: Transplants relocate healthy hair follicles to areas of thinning or baldness.
  • Expected results: Permanent hair restoration in the transplanted areas.
  • Timeline: Full results are usually visible within 9-12 months.
  • Potential side effects: Scarring, infection, and uneven hair growth.

Other Therapies: Laser Therapy and PRP

Low-Level Laser Therapy (LLLT)

LLLT uses laser devices to stimulate hair follicles and promote hair growth. It's available in various forms, including laser caps and combs.

  • Cost: LLLT devices can range from 200€ to 1,000€ upfront.
  • How it works: LLLT increases blood flow and stimulates cellular activity in hair follicles.
  • Expected results: Some studies show modest improvements in hair density.
  • Timeline: Consistent use over several months is required.
  • Potential side effects: Generally safe, but some users report scalp irritation.

Platelet-Rich Plasma (PRP) Therapy

PRP therapy involves injecting a concentration of your own platelets into the scalp to stimulate hair growth.

  • Cost: PRP treatments typically cost between 400€ and 1,000€ per session, and multiple sessions are usually needed.
  • How it works: Platelets contain growth factors that promote tissue regeneration and hair follicle stimulation.
  • Expected results: Improved hair thickness and density in some individuals.
  • Timeline: Results are usually seen after a series of treatments over several months.
  • Potential side effects: Scalp pain, swelling, and risk of infection.
